Hi im trying to get Win xp pro on my 1520 laptop. But i get HDD not found error while it's checking my system. I have seen some other forums on this but not sure what to do.
I burnt the SATA drivers on a CD and press F6 and insert the CD when it asks for the Sata drivers. But when i hit "enter" it does nothing.
It also refers to the cd/dvd drive as "A" When asking for the drivers or XP CD to continue without the drivers.
Please help!

I think it's expecting the drivers to be on a floppy drive. If you don't have a floppy drive, you might have to slipstream the drivers on to your install CD.

"It also refers to the cd/dvd drive as "A" ..."
Setup, at that point, cannot recognize anything but the proper drivers on a floppy disk in a floppy drive - it cannot find drivers on a CD or a flash drive or a hard drive or on all except a few very old USB connected floppy drive models that were available when XP was first released.
Also see response 5 in this - if you can set your bios to IDE compatible mode, you won't need load the drivers during Setup, Setup will see the drive no problem, and you can optionally load SATA or RAID drivers later:
